The Ancient Xiate Road

An introduction of  Xiate road (recited)

The ancient Xiate road begins from Zhaosu county in Ili, and ends at the Pochengzi, Wensu county in Aksu.

Xiate road is the most dangerous road along the Silk Road, and was closely connecting the northern and southern of Tianshan mountains in the mid 1900s.

With the open up of the railway between northern and southern Xinjiang, the ancient Xiate road now becomes an itinerary for hikers.
